Navigating the World of Supplements Wisely
Embarking on a journey into the world of supplements can be both exciting. With a extensive array of options available, choosing the right ones for your specific needs can feel overwhelming. To navigate this landscape effectively, it's crucial to approach supplement acquisition with a informed eye.
- First and foremost, consult your healthcare provider. They can analyze your existing health status, identify any potential deficiencies, and suggest supplements that enhance your overall well-being.
- Then, take the time to investigate different categories of supplements. Comprehend their intended effects and potential side effects with any medications you may be utilizing.
- Always opt for supplements from reliable brands that comply strict manufacturing standards. Look for third-party certifications, such as USP or NSF, which indicate the effectiveness of the product.
Bear this in mind that supplements are not a replacement for a healthy way of living. These a way to address potential shortfalls in your intake. Through following these guidelines, you can make informed decisions about incorporating supplements into your routine.
The Science Behind Supplements: Fact vs. Fiction Myth Busters
Delving into the realm of supplements can be a labyrinth of confusing information, often blurring the lines between scientific backing and marketing exaggerated claims. While some supplements offer genuine benefits, others fall prey to unsubstantiated assertions. To navigate this landscape effectively, it's crucial to understand the scientific basis behind these products and distinguish fact from fiction.
A key aspect in evaluating supplements is to scrutinize the available research. Look for robust scientific studies published in reputable journals that illustrate a clear link between the supplement and its purported results. Be wary of anecdotal testimonials or promotional materials that often lack objective backing.
It's also important to consult a qualified health professional before incorporating any new supplement into your routine, especially if you have existing medical conditions or are taking prescriptions. A healthcare provider can help assess the potential risks and benefits of a particular supplement based on your individual needs and health history.

Delving into the Supplement Marketplace: A Guide to Quality and Safety
With a surging number of supplement options available on the market, it can be difficult to discern reliable products. To help you navigate this complex landscape, consider these crucial tips. Firstly, always choose supplements from reputable brands recognized by their strict quality protocols. Look for third-party certifications such as NSF or USP, which indicate that the product has been carefully tested for purity and potency. Additionally, scrutinize the ingredient list, ensuring that you understand what you are taking. Consult with your healthcare provider before starting any new supplement regimen, especially if you have pre-existing conditions or are using drugs.
- Bear in mind that supplements are not a replacement of a healthy diet and lifestyle.
- Store supplements properly to ensure their effectiveness and safety.
By following these guidelines, you can confidently navigate the supplement marketplace and make informed choices that support your overall well-being.
